Solve the system of equations by substitution:
y= x - 2
x+y=12

A. (7,5)
B. (5,3)
C. (0, 1)
D. (14, 12)

Answer:

y=x-2

so ...

x+(x-2)=12

2x-2=12

2x=12+2

2x=14

x=14/2

x=7

x+y=12

7+y=12

y=12-7

y=5
